Transaction 577c311d951bcfd64ea0a302707938aee24455a7ac5085da4ebcb4eeedade362
1 Input
1 Output
-
577c311d951bcfd64ea0a302707938aee24455a7ac5085da4ebcb4eeedade362:0
- value
- 314621
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31424cc20c3d0c37bb1f5aa3d45417b1f893a8d9 OP_EQUAL
- address
- 36BUTY64afMFWwxyPbBo3FycZwmNdjbQK8